Lightbulb How to prepare EDS paper?

This paper is conisdered as one of the most important papers in compulsory subjects as one can score 80+ marks in it. And this subject can really make a difference for a candidate.
Now, there are a number of books in the market from different authors which are recomended by seniors (bhatti,kashmiri, dr.rab nawaz etc).

I think that it is tha approach that matter in preparing this subject ratehr than to learn all the books by heart (though it is important) as it will take more time and extra effort.

The purpose of this thread is to share the approaches and methods for preparing EDS used by qualified seniors and members of the forum which would definitely help aspirants in effectively dealing with EDS.

Default how to prepare EDS

yes dear omer u r right. EDS is the most important compulsory paper in CSS. so its preparation is necessary keeping in view of its scoring a lot for scientists and not scoring even a few marks for unlearned.

however for scoring average in this subject by every one i dont think that u should read a lot of books. my simple suggestion is that read science books of 6th 7th and 8th. these will provide u a lot of help. for some extra topics u may also read the kashmiri's book.

dont read extra books general science books of these classes are sufficient.

Default to omer and saqib

dear i have already appeared in css and am not preparing for the next attempt. my papers were fine and i am hopeful of my result.

as fos as EDS paper is concerned dear i didnt say that u should completely rely on these books. instead of this u should also consult other books as well like kashmiri's book. dear most of the EDS topics can easily be covered from my suggested books which are really gist of EDS and if u go through them then u guess that how helpful they are. dear even though i have a master degree in science and a good knowledge of everyday science yet i still read these books during my CSS preparation.

as some body said how we get knowledge about solar system from these books. dear if u read last chapters of all these books of Punjab board u will find complete and thorough information about this topic. same holds true for all other topics as well.

only a few topics like role of muslims in the field of scienc, semiconductors and some electronic equipments may be approached from kashmiri's books.
